This series of portraits is based on the notion of family, uniting the two worlds of each fighter, their role as a star in the ring brought to their home, where they are loving parents, providers, people who protect others. Some portraits were made at the very precise moment before going out to the ring to fight, in an arena that only works on weekends, in one of the few spaces where this sport / entertainment is still preserved in Guatemala City

Jorge Luis Chavarría is a photographer and artist. His work explores gender, culture, identity, and placement. His work is a crossroads of documentary photography, design, and contemporary art. He studied systems engineering at the San Carlos University in Guatemala. A self-taught photographer and darkroom printer, Jorge's work combine photography with design sets and performance, in order to explore gender, culture, and placement. His work is a crossroads of documentary photography, design, and contemporary art. Jorge's work has been exhibited in the principal museums and galleries in Guatemala, El Salvador, and Puerto Rico, England and the United States.
